如何优化axi outstanding
时间: 2023-05-31 19:05:49 浏览: 107
Axi outstanding是指在AXI总线上等待传输的未完成事务的数量。 以下是优化Axi outstanding的一些方法:
1. 增加AXI总线的带宽和速度,可以减少Axi outstanding。这可以通过增加总线的频率或者增加总线的宽度来实现。
2. 优化AXI总线的交互方式,例如通过重排列传输顺序,减少传输之间的空隙,从而减少Axi outstanding。
3. 减少总线负载,通过减少总线上的传输数量,可以减少Axi outstanding。这可以通过优化内存访问模式,尽量减少乱序访问等方式实现。
4. 优化片上内存的访问,通过减少片上内存访问的时间和延迟,可以减少Axi outstanding。这可以通过优化存储器的结构和实现方式来实现。
5. 优化片上总线的带宽和速度,通过增加片上总线的带宽和速度,可以减少Axi outstanding。这可以通过增加总线的频率或者增加总线的宽度来实现。
相关问题
axi outstanding代码
axi outstanding代码是一种处理高性能和高效率互联的技术。它主要用于在处理器和外设之间进行通信,使用了一种可扩展的协议,能够实现多个事务之间的并行处理。在axi outstanding代码中,outstanding事务是指在数据传输完成之前,处理器可以发起的未完成的事务数量。通常来说,outstanding事务的数量越多,处理器与外设之间的通信并行度就越高,因此可以提高系统的整体性能。
使用axi outstanding代码需要对系统的整体设计和性能进行充分的考量。首先,需要确认系统中的处理器和外设是否支持axi协议,如果不支持,则需要进行适配或者更换硬件。其次,需要根据系统的实际需求和性能要求来确定outstanding事务的数量,以保证系统能够达到最佳的性能表现。最后,需要对整个系统进行充分的测试和验证,确保axi outstanding代码在系统中能够稳定可靠地运行。
总的来说,axi outstanding代码是一种能够提高处理器和外设通信效率的技术,但是在实际应用中需要充分考虑系统的整体设计和性能需求,以确保能够发挥最大的优势。
axi outstanding
"AXI outstanding" 可能指的是 AXI 总线上处于等待传输的数据包数量。AXI(Advanced eXtensible Interface)总线是一种高性能、低功耗、可扩展的总线协议,广泛应用于 SoC(System on Chip)和 FPGA(Field Programmable Gate Array)中。AXI 总线上的数据传输是通过传输数据包实现的,如果某些数据包还未被处理,就会被认为是 "outstanding"。因此,"AXI outstanding" 可以理解为当前 AXI 总线上还未被处理的数据包的数量。